How do you find the GCF of 98 and 28?

Hint: The GCF is the greatest common factor that means GCF of 2 or more numbers is the greatest number which is a factor of all the numbers given. We can find the GCF of 2 numbers by writing all the numbers as the product of their prime factors, then we can take all the common factors and their product will be GCF. For example a=$3\times 3\times 3$ and b=$3\times 3$ then common factors are 3 and 3. There are two 3 in common so the GCF is 9.

Complete step by step answer:
We have to find the GCF of 98 and 28
To find GCF of above 2 numbers let’s write the numbers as a product of their prime factors and then take all the common factors out.
So we can write 98 as $2\times 7\times 7$
We can write 28 as $2\times 2\times 7$
We can the common factors are one 2 and one 7 so the GCF of 98 and 28 is $2\times 7=14$
This is one way we can find the GCF.

Note:
If GCF of 2 numbers is 1 then we call the 2 numbers as co-prime. Given 2 integers the product of LCM and GCF of 2 numbers is always equal to the product of the 2 numbers whose LCM is the lowest common multiple of the numbers. So if LCM is given and a product of 2 numbers is given then GCF will be a product divided by LCM.
